  • Cleartrade Exchange Announces First Trade Of New Mini Fertilizer Futures

    Date 18/05/2015

    Cleartrade Exchange (CLTX), the Singapore regulated futures exchange for commodity derivatives, announces the first trade for its new mini fertilizer futures contracts. The contracts launched on Thursday May 14th with the first trades observed on CLTX later that day.

  • China Securities Regulatory Commission: FAQ On Beneficial Ownership Under SH-HK Stock Connect

    Date 18/05/2015

    1. Do overseas investors enjoy proprietary rights in the SSE Securities acquired through the Northbound Trading Link as shareholders? Are the concepts of "nominee holder" and "beneficial owner" recognized under Mainland  law?

    Article 18 of the Administrative Measures for Registration and Settlement of Securities (the “Settlement Measures”) states that “securities shall be recorded in the accounts of the securities holders, unless laws, administrative regulations or CSRC rules prescribe that the securities shall be recorded in accounts opened in the name of nominee holders”. Hence, the Settlement Measuresexpressly provides for the concept of nominee shareholding. Article 13 of the Certain Provisions on Shanghai-Hong Kong Stock Connect Pilot Program (the “CSRC Stock Connect Rules”) states that shares acquired by investors through the Northbound Trading Link shall be registered in the name of HKSCC and that “investors are legally entitled to the rights and benefits of shares acquired through the Northbound Trading Link”. Accordingly, the CSRC Stock Connect Rules have expressly stipulated that, in Northbound trading, overseas investors shall hold SSE Securities through HKSCC and are entitled to proprietary interests in such securities as shareholders.
